About

Perton Wrottesley is a predominantly residential ward within the larger village of Perton, located in South Staffordshire. The area is characterised by modern housing estates, with many homes built from the latter half of the 20th century onwards. It contains local amenities including shops, schools, and community facilities that serve its residents. The layout is typical of a planned suburban expansion, with a focus on providing housing and necessary services within a contained environment.

The ward is bordered by green spaces, including areas of farmland and the grounds of the former Perton Hall estate. A notable local feature is the presence of the Smestow Valley, a wildlife corridor that passes nearby. The ward's name incorporates Wrottesley, referencing the historic Wrottesley family whose ancestral hall lies just outside its boundary, lending a historical context to the newer developments. Transport links are primarily road-based, connecting residents to Wolverhampton and wider Staffordshire.

Area overview

On average Perton Wrottesley has very low deprivation and very high crime levels. Approximately 1.3%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Perton Wrottesley is £57,272 per year.

Frequently asked questions about Perton Wrottesley

What is the average house price in Perton Wrottesley?

The median sale price in Perton Wrottesley is £260,000 (about £326 per square foot) based on 29 registered sales according to HM Land Registry data.

How deprived is Perton Wrottesley?

Perton Wrottesley scores 2 out of 10 on the deprivation scale, where 10 is the most deprived. The typical neighbourhood in Perton Wrottesley sits around rank 28,601 of 32,844 in England on the official Index of Multiple Deprivation (rank 1 is the most deprived).

What is the average household income in Perton Wrottesley?

The average household income in Perton Wrottesley is around £57,272 per year, and 1% of homes are social housing (ONS data).
